Benefits

Treatment of G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ux) / Treatment of Intestinal ulcers / Treatment of Irritable bowel syndromeTreatment of G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ux) / Treatment of Intestinal ulcers / Treatment of Irritable bowel syndrome

In Treatment of G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ux)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) is a chronic (long-term) condition in which there is an excess production of acid in the stomach. Tyuzol L Tablet reduces the amount of acid your stomach makes and relieves the pain associated with heartburn and acid reflux. You should take it exactly as it is prescribed for it to be effective. Some simple lifestyle changes can help reduce the symptoms of GERD. Think about what foods trigger heartburn and try to avoid them; eat smaller, more frequent meals; try to lose weight if you are overweight and try to find ways to relax. Do not eat within 3-4 hours of going to bed. In Treatment of Intestinal ulcers Intestinal ulcers are painful sores that develop in the inner lining of the stomach or gut (intestine). Tyuzol L Tablet reduces the amount of acid your stomach makes which prevents further damage to the ulcer as it heals naturally. You may be given other medicines along with this medicine depending on what caused the ulcer. You need to keep taking Tyuzol L Tablet as prescribed by the doctor for it to be effective, even if the symptoms seem to disappear. In Treatment of Irritable bowel syndrome Irritable bowel syndrome is a chronic (long-term) inflammatory disease of the large intestine (colon) that usually needs long term management. This can lead to bleeding, frequent diarrhea, bloating, flatulence, cramps and stomach pain. Tyuzol L Tablet relaxes the muscles in your stomach and gut (intestine) and relieves these symptoms effectively. Usually, it is used along with other medicines for management of your condition. Continue taking it for as long as the doctor may advise you to. You need to take this medicine regularly to get the most out of it. How it works

Tyuzol L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Levosulpiride and Rabeprazole. Levosulpiride is a prokinetic which works by increasing the release of acetylcholine (a chemical messenger). This increases the movement of stomach and intestines, and prevents reflux (acid going up to the food pipe). Rabeprazole is a proton pump inhibitor (PPI). It works by reducing the amount of acid in the stomach which helps in the relief of acid-related indigestion and ulcers.Tyuzol L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Levosulpiride and Rabeprazole.
